Augmented antitumor effects of radiation therapy by 4-1BB antibody (BMS-469492) treatment.

BACKGROUND: 4-1BB (CD137) is a member of the tumor necrosis factor receptor superfamily. It interacts with 4-1BB ligand (4-1BBL) and delivers a costimulatory signal for T cell activation.
